On Monday afternoon, Governor Andrew Cuomo announced that Rockland will finally be receiving a mass vaccination site of its own. Despite leading the state in infections and deaths due to COVID-19, Rocklanders have previously had to rely on mass vaccination sites in Westchester County and other areas to receive the vital medication. Last Friday afternoon the Spring Valley Police Department responded to reports of shots fired in the vicinity of 34 Monsey Blvd. Upon arrival, officers located two men suffering from gunshot wounds and rushed both of them to Westchester Medical Center.
